CMS Energy

On Tuesday, shares in Jackson, Michigan headquartered CMS Energy Corp. recorded a trading volume of 3.16 million shares, which was higher than their three months average volume of 3.00 million shares. The stock ended at $44.75, rising 2.12% from the last trading session. The Company's shares have gained 2.24% in the last month. The stock is trading above its 50-day moving average by 2.92%. Furthermore, shares of CMS Energy, which operates as an energy company primarily in Michigan, have a Relative Strength Index (RSI) of 59.89. Great Plains Energy

Kansas City, Missouri headquartered Great Plains Energy Inc.'s stock finished yesterday's session 1.57% higher at $31.14. A total volume of 2.46 million shares was traded, which was above their three months average volume of 1.53 million shares. The Company's shares have gained 7.86% in the last twelve months. The stock is trading above its 50-day moving average by 2.91%. Furthermore, shares of the Company, which through its subsidiaries, generates, transmits, distributes, and sells electricity, have an RSI of 58.65. Hawaiian Electric Industries

At the close of trading on Tuesday, shares in Honolulu, Hawaii headquartered Hawaiian Electric Industries Inc. saw a rise of 1.21%, ending the day at $34.22. The stock recorded a trading volume of 280,046 shares. The Company's shares have advanced 2.27 % over the last twelve months. The stock is trading above its 50-day moving average by 1.97%. Moreover, shares of the Company, which through its subsidiaries, engages in the electric utility and banking businesses primarily in the state of Hawaii, have an RSI of 56.87. PPL Corp.

Allentown, Pennsylvania headquartered PPL Corp.'s shares ended the day 1.64% higher at $27.90 with a total trading volume of 6.98 million shares, which was above their three months average of 6.90 million shares. The Company's shares are trading below their 50-day moving average by 6.05%. Additionally, shares of PPL Corp., which delivers electricity and natural gas in the US and the UK, have an RSI of 43.68.
